The contract award for the CARTO 3 Electro-Anatomical Mapping System Service Plan, identified by solicitation number 36C25626C0017, was issued as a sole-source, firm-fixed-price agreement totaling $1,020,000 under FAR 13.106-1(b)(2) to Biosense Webster, Inc. The procurement was justified due to the proprietary nature of the CARTO 3 system, which requires exclusive manufacturer support for hardware, software updates, and technical maintenance, with no viable alternatives identified after market research through SAM.gov notice 36C25626Q0081. The contract encompasses a three-year period of performance beginning December 23, 2025, and concluding on December 22, 2028, structured as a base year with two optional one-year extensions, covering comprehensive service and support to ensure uninterrupted system functionality at the Department of Veterans Affairs facility in Houston, Texas. All services must be delivered by OEM-certified technicians, adhering to Biosense Webster’s proprietary specifications, with no external technical standards explicitly referenced beyond the manufacturer’s requirements. The contracting office is the Department of Veterans Affairs’ Network Contracting Office 16, located in Ridgeland, Mississippi, with the point of contact being Contract Specialist Shasta Britt, reachable via email and phone. No subcontracting, socioeconomic, or security clearance requirements are indicated, and no contract line item numbers or funding details beyond the total value are available. The place of performance is firmly established in Houston, Texas, with inspection and acceptance occurring at that location.
